Pros and Cons of OLED and LCD Displays: Professional Insights from Limito Technology

OLED (Organic Light Emitting Diode) displays, the core focus of Limito Technology’s R&D and customization services, boast remarkable advantages driven by their self-luminous working principle. Unlike LCDs that rely on a backlight module, each pixel of an OLED display can emit light independently, enabling perfect black performance and theoretically infinite contrast ratio, which delivers a more layered and immersive visual experience, especially in dark scenes. Additionally, OLED screens are thinner and lighter, with excellent flexibility that supports innovative forms like curved and foldable displays, making them ideal for high-end custom products such as wearable devices and premium smartphones. They also feature ultra-fast response speed (microsecond level), eliminating motion blur , which is highly suitable for gaming and dynamic content display. In terms of power consumption, OLEDs are more energy-efficient when displaying dark content, as turned-off pixels consume no electricity.
However, OLED displays also have obvious drawbacks. The most prominent issue is the risk of burn-in, caused by the irreversible degradation of organic light-emitting materials—blue sub-pixels degrade 2-3 times faster than red and green ones, leading to uneven aging after long-term static image display. Moreover, OLEDs have relatively higher manufacturing costs, especially for large-size panels, which limits their popularization in cost-sensitive scenarios. When displaying large-area bright content, OLEDs often limit brightness to avoid overheating and burn-in, resulting in lower full-screen peak brightness compared to top LCDs. Additionally, organic materials will gradually attenuate over time, affecting the long-term brightness stability of the screen.
LCD (Liquid Crystal Display) displays, as a mature and widely used technology, have their own irreplaceable advantages. Their biggest strength lies in cost-effectiveness—mature manufacturing processes lead to lower production costs, making them the preferred choice for large-size displays and budget-friendly products. LCDs have stable long-term performance, with uniform aging of backlight modules, almost no burn-in risk, and a longer overall service life (usually 50,000-100,000 hours). They also excel in full-screen peak brightness, easily reaching over 1000 nits, ensuring clear visibility even in bright outdoor environments or well-lit rooms. Furthermore, LCD power consumption is relatively stable, less affected by display content, which is more suitable for devices that need to work for a long time with fixed bright interfaces.
The limitations of LCD displays are closely related to their backlight working principle. Due to the inability to completely turn off the backlight, LCDs cannot achieve pure black, resulting in lower contrast and obvious light leakage in dark scenes. Their response speed is relatively slow (millisecond level), which may cause slight motion blur when displaying fast-moving content. In terms of physical form, LCDs are thicker and heavier due to the need for backlight and liquid crystal layers, and cannot achieve flexible display. Their viewing angle is also limited—color and brightness may shift when viewed from the side, especially for non-IPS LCD panels.
